More Than Just Oil Changes: The Science of Modern Car Systems


When people think of car upkeep, they normally visualize an oil adjustment or perhaps inspecting tire pressure. While those are essential, they only scratch the surface. Cars today are crafted with advanced systems that connect with each other in real-time. From sensors that track temperature and stress to software application that readjusts engine efficiency on the fly, your vehicle is more smart than you may think.


The engine, for instance, is a wonder of combustion scientific research. Gas blends with air, presses in the cyndrical tube, and sparks to press pistons that transform your wheels. This process occurs countless times per minute and requires precise timing, optimal fuel-to-air proportions, and a cooling system that protects against getting too hot. Normal upkeep makes sure that all these moving parts continue to be in sync, protecting against unneeded wear and taking full advantage of performance.


Understanding the Heartbeat of Your Vehicle: Diagnostics and Data


Among one of the most underrated elements of automobile maintenance is diagnostics. Your lorry's onboard computer system collects information regularly, keeping an eye on every function from exhausts to engine tons. When that check engine light pops on, it's not just a generic caution-- it could be signifying a large array of concerns ranging from a loosened gas cap to something much more serious like a falling short oxygen sensor.


Professionals utilize diagnostic devices to access this information, translating the info right into actionable fixings. It's like running a health check on your vehicle. Without this understanding, mechanics would be left presuming, and your vehicle may endure more damage in the future. That's why normal evaluations and check-ups are so crucial.

Brake systems function making use of hydraulic stress to push pads versus blades, reducing the wheels via rubbing. With time, those pads wear down, liquid can degrade, and small issues can become dangerous failures. What could begin as a soft pedal or a mild sound can promptly rise right into a situation where quiting your lorry takes longer than it should.
